Waters, a nominee for the 2001 class of the Pro Football Hall of Fame, currently holds the NFL record for most interceptions in playoff games, including three in one game, and is second in Dallas history in career pickoffs with 50.

Respected for his courage and knowledge by opponents and teammates alike, Waters was selected to the Pro Bowl three times. Additionally, he was named All-Pro three times. A fan favorite, he was twice voted as a Favorite Cowboy.

After retirement, he worked as an NFL analyst for CBS Sports before re-entering the NFL as a coach. In his seven seasons on the sideline with the Denver Broncos, Waters advanced himself to defensive coordinator and his team to the playoffs four times.

In 1996, Waters and his family returned to Dallas, and he returned to the private business sector where he is involved with many community and charitable activities including the Fellowship of Christian Athletes, I'm Third Foundation of Kanakuk Kamps, Boles Home for Children, CASA and the Cody Waters Memorial Fund.
